The National Costume Museum of Beijing Institute of Fashion Technology is a museum of costumes and a cultural research institution integrating collection, display, scientific research and teaching. It is one of the best clothing museums in China. It collects more than 10,000 pieces of clothing, accessories, and fabrics of all ethnic groups in China, as well as nearly 1,000 pictures of the lives of the Yi, Tibetan and Qiang peoples in the 1930s. width. The museum has seven exhibition halls and a Chinese traditional costume crafts hall for young people and the public to learn, understand the traditional skills of national costumes, and conduct interactive exchanges. There are many silver ornaments in the metalworking jewelry hall, such as head ornaments, earrings, necklaces, breast ornaments, bracelets, rings and silver bubbles, silver flowers, silver pieces, silver bells and so on. In the Minority Costume Hall, there are famous costumes of Manchu, Mongolian, Tibetan, Oroqen, Ewenki, Tajik, Kazakh, Kirgiz, Yugu and other ethnic groups. There are various styles such as robes, long shirts, dresses, large-breasted dresses, large-breasted trousers, double-breasted dresses, double-breasted trousers, slanted dresses, and cross-headed clothes. Textile, embroidery and batik national costumes in the weaving, dyeing and embroidery hall. The old photo gallery displays a batch of ethnic investigation pictures in the 1930s, which were taken by the famous ethnologist and photographer Mr. Zhuang Xueben. The photos taken by Mr. Zhuang are very rich in content, reflecting the actual situation of the Yi, Qiang and Tibetan nationalities in terms of social history, economy, religion, culture and living customs at that time. In the Miao costume hall, there are different styles from the fine and gorgeous Shidong Miao costumes to the primitive and rough Nandan Miao costumes. The Han Nationality Costume Hall displays the Han nationality's modern and modern costumes from different regions and different types. 北京服装学院民族服饰博物馆位于北京服装学院内。2000年成立,是中国第一家服饰类专业博物馆,具有收藏、展示、科研、教学等多方面的功能。曾荣获“全国博物十大陈列精品——最佳制作奖”。博物馆面积2000平方米,设有少数民族服饰厅、汉族服饰厅、苗族服饰厅、金工首饰厅、织锦刺绣蜡染厅、奥运服饰厅、图片厅等七个展厅。
